NeighbourhoodThis detached house on Floralaan sits in a quiet part of Hardenberg, with a large garden and plenty of space inside. At 257 m², it's a generous family home with an energy label A, so running costs should be low. The asking price of €625,000 is in line with what other detached houses in Hardenberg go for.
Baalderveld is a residential area with mostly families and a calm, green feel. One resident says: "It's a cosy neighbourhood with lots of things nearby." The neighbourhood has a mix of ages, with many households with children and a high proportion of owner-occupied homes. Average incomes are above the national average, and the area feels safe and well-maintained. For more details, see the neighbourhood Baalderveld page.
For your daily shopping, PLUS is just around the corner, you can walk there in seconds. There are also Aldi, Jumbo, Albert Heijn and Lidl within a short drive. Schools are close by: Kindcentrum De Bloemenhof and De Morgenster Gereformeerde Basisschool are both a couple of streets away, and OBS 't Spectrum is a five-minute walk. The municipality Hardenberg offers good amenities, including a train station 2.1 km away.

About Floralaan 33, Hardenberg
The price of €625,000 is in line with the market for detached homes in Hardenberg. With 257 m² of living space and a 467 m² plot, you get a lot of space for your money. The energy label A also means lower energy costs, which adds to the value.
Baalderveld is a quiet, family-oriented neighbourhood with a cosy atmosphere. One resident describes it as 'a cosy neighbourhood with lots of things nearby.' It has a high percentage of owner-occupied homes and many families with children. The area feels safe and green, with good local amenities.
The PLUS supermarket is just 22 metres away, literally on your doorstep. Other supermarkets like Aldi, Jumbo, Albert Heijn and Lidl are within 1.5 to 1.7 km, so you have plenty of choice for your weekly shop.
Yes, there are several primary schools within walking distance. Kindcentrum De Bloemenhof and De Morgenster Gereformeerde Basisschool are both about 160 metres away, and OBS 't Spectrum is around 200 metres. For secondary education, PrO Hardenberg is about 600 metres away.
The home has energy label A, which is very efficient. This means you can expect low heating and electricity costs compared to older homes. The house was built in 1993, so it likely has good insulation and modern installations.
